Community Safety and Preparedness
What Residents Should Do Now
If you are in the affected area, stay inside a secure location, close and lock doors, turn off exterior lights, and silence electronic devices. Monitor local radio, TV, and official apps for updates. Prepare an emergency kit with essentials in case instructions escalate to extended shelter.
Long-Term Preparedness Tips
While no one can predict violence with certainty, households can adopt simple protocols: identify escape routes, establish meeting points, and keep emergency contacts saved. Review workplace or school active-shooter plans, and consider basic first-aid training to assist if professional responders are delayed.
